Festa di San Michele

Festa di San Michele, from 28th September to 1st October 2023 (St. Michael 29th September), is the main town festival of Bagnacavallo and it celebrates the patron saint of the town.

The first documents in which the feast is mentioned date back to 1202. Nowadays the setting of the festival are the streets, the squares and the most beautiful spots of the historical town centre.

During these days, Bagnacavallo offers the chance to discover old noble palaces, hidden courtyard as well as churches with works of art. Many events enliven the town centre: street theatre events, concerts, sacred music and guided tours to discover the beauties of the town.

Several taverns open on this occasion in original places, such as courtyards, cloisters and mansion houses where it is possible to enjoy the typical cuisine of Romagna or original dishes of the feast: worth of mention are the cakes “dolce di San Michele” with honey and dried fruits, “Migliaccio” made with pork blood, “Savòr” with apples and quinces, “Sugal” a cake made with wine most, “Mistochine” and “Piadot” made with chestnut flour.
